The moon has more gravitational attraction than the Earth.
a. True
b. False

That can be either true or false, depending on the location
of the object being gravitationally attracted.

The gravitational attraction between you and anything else
depends on the mass of the other thing and your distance from it.

If you're on the line between the Earth and the moon, and
anywhere within about 24,000 miles of the moon, then
you'll be attracted toward the moon more strongly than
toward the Earth.
